View moreThe solar controller (should be MPPT type, not PWM) takes the high voltage from solar panels (14v+) and converts it into higher amps. This keeps batteries charged with lower voltage (lead acid ~ 13.4v, LifePO4 ~14.5v) and the higher amps charges them faster (think turning up the speed of a faucet to fill a cup).

View moreSolar Panel May Detach. A detached solar panel can become a road hazard and increase the crash risk. Potential Number of Affected Units: 67. Tiffin is recalling certain 2023-2024 Convoy and GH-1 motorhomes. The bracket that secures the solar panel to the roof may crack and break, which can cause the solar panel to detach.

View moreNewcomer RV manufacturer Brinkley RV warns solar wiring problems could cause a wiring overheat situation—with the potential of a fire. Brinkley RV (Brinkley) is recalling certain 2024-2025 Model G fifth wheel trailers. The solar panels may have been incorrectly wired, which can overload the circuits and cause the wiring to overheat.
